2024年5月27日发(作者:)
ocr文字识别详解
一、概述
OCR(Optical Character Recognition)技术是一种将图像中的
文字转换成可编辑和可搜索的文本的技术。OCR技术广泛应用于各种领
域,如文档处理、图像分析、自动化识别等。本文将详细介绍OCR技
术的原理、应用、优缺点以及常见的OCR软件。
二、OCR原理
OCR技术的基本原理是通过光学扫描设备将纸质文档或图像中的
文字转换为电子化的文字。具体来说,OCR系统通常包括以下几个步
骤:
1. 图像预处理:对原始图像进行去噪、灰度化、二值化等处理,
以提高文字识别的准确性。
2. 文字定位:通过识别图像中的字符形状,确定文字区域。
3. 特征提取:对文字区域中的字符进行特征提取,如笔画、边界
等。
4. 匹配与识别:根据提取的特征,将字符与数据库中的标准字符
进行匹配,识别出具体的文字。
OCR技术的核心是文本检测和识别算法。文本检测算法用于确定
文字区域,常用的算法有边缘检测算法、霍夫变换等。识别算法则根
据提取的特征,将字符与数据库中的标准字符进行匹配,常用的算法
有基于模板匹配、神经网络等。
三、OCR应用
OCR技术的应用非常广泛,包括但不限于以下领域:
第 1 页 共 3 页
1. 文档处理:将纸质文档转换为电子化文档,便于存储、传输和
编辑。
2. 图像分析:通过对图像中的文字进行识别,提取关键信息,如
车牌号码、人脸识别等。
3. 自动化识别:在生产线、物流等领域,通过OCR技术实现自动
化识别和分拣。
四、OCR优缺点
OCR技术的优点:
1. 提高了文字识别的准确性,降低了人为误判的可能性。
2. 降低了对硬件设备的要求,如打印机、扫描仪等。
3. 实现了文字的无纸化传输和编辑,方便了信息的共享和利用。
OCR技术的缺点:
1. 对扫描质量的要求较高,扫描质量差可能导致识别错误。
2. 对文字的字体、字号和排版有要求,不同的字体和字号可能需
要不同的识别算法。
3. 对复杂背景和干扰因素(如阴影、反光等)的抵抗力较弱。
五、常见OCR软件介绍
目前市面上有很多OCR软件可供选择,以下介绍几款常用的OCR
软件:
1. Adobe Acrobat:Adobe Acrobat是Adobe公司的一款产品,
它提供了OCR功能,可以将扫描后的图像中的文字转换为可编辑的文
本。
第 2 页 共 3 页
2. ABBYY FineReader:ABBYY FineReader是一款知名的OCR软
件,它拥有强大的OCR技术,可以识别各种字体、字号和排版的文
字,并提供了多种语言支持。
3. Microsoft Office OneNote:Microsoft Office OneNote是
一款笔记软件,它内置了OCR功能,可以将扫描后的文档快速转换为
可编辑的文本,方便了笔记和资料的整理和利用。
六、总结
OCR技术是一种重要的文字识别技术,它能够将图像中的文字转
换为可编辑和可搜索的文本,广泛应用于各种领域。本文从原理、应
用、优缺点以及常见OCR软件等方面对OCR技术进行了详细介绍。随
着技术的不断发展,相信OCR技术将会在更多领域得到应用和发展。
第 3 页 共 3 页
发布评论